E-Verify Rings in the New Year with Shadows of 2020 | Seyfarth Shaw LLP

To embed, copy and paste the code into your website or blog: As employers across the country started 2021 with optimism for a better year, E-Verify was stuck in 2020, experiencing a short period of technical trouble. The site was down unexpectedly from Monday, January 5 at 1:53 PM EST until Tuesday, January 6 at 8:06 PM EST. Both the Web Services and Direct Access portals were affected. Background on the Program E-Verify was first authorized by Congress in 1996, allowing employers to electronically confirm their employees’ employment eligibility to work in the United States. Earth Today | UNIDO gets nod from Adaptation Fund

OLLIKAINEN THE UNITED Nations Industrial Development Organisation (UNIDO) was accredited by the Adaptation Fund as its 52nd implementing entity, following a virtual inter-sessional board decision last month.
